> Hi all-
>
> I'm confused about deployments with maven rc1. I have the
> jar deployment
> stuff working perfectly. Setting these properties:
>
> maven.repo.central=myrepo.mycompany
> maven.repo.central.directory=/www/maven-repo
> maven.username=lnelson
> maven.remote.group=users
> maven.ssh.executable=plink
> maven.scp.executable=pscp
>
> Well, I tried to start using ear & war deployment. And, it didn't
> work. After some research, I found that these plugins use
> the "artifact"
> plugin to do their deployments. So, I added all these properties to
> support this:
>
> maven.repo.list=myrepo
> maven.repo.myrepo=scp://myrepo.mycompany
> maven.repo.myrepo.directory=/www/maven-repo
> maven.repo.myrepo.username=lnelson
> maven.repo.myrepo.privatekey=/private/private-key
> maven.repo.myrepo.passphrase=mypassphrase # YUCKY! Want to
> use pageant!
> maven.repo.myrepo.group=users
>
> But, It seems that these plugins do the SAME thing, but the
> artifact plugin
> won't work with putty and pageant. It requires me to provide
> my private
> key and passphrase (and it can't read the putty private keys).
>
> So, am I missing something here? How do I deploy wars &
> ears using putty
> (pscp) and pageant? That's the most convenient! It looks like the
> artifact plugin uses JCraft (
> http://www.jcraft.com/jsch/index.html ) which
> doesn't
> support the idea of ssh-agents.
